NoName Posted July 20, 2015 Author Report Share Posted July 20, 2015 This is the one I tried. ONLY USED ONE SIDE, since I only own 1 W6. This one is about 35L can't really tell anything else (I sold it yesterday), it was designed for 10W3v3 if I recall corectly, but I did not enjoy the outcome of it. It was pretty close to what you hear in the video from 1:00. Hard, loud, overpowering mids and highs in some songs if not turned down.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Joe X Posted July 20, 2015 Report Share Posted July 20, 2015 Just looking how wide are the ports i'd say it was tuned way high, what you describe, playing midbass really strong pretty much confirms that, also theses subs are recommended for 1.5 net usually more is given, from your comment 1.2 cubic feet was given, no doubt you are in for a new box.
